Title of article :
New derivatives of poly-hexafluoropropylene oxide from the corresponding alcohol

Abstract :
Poly-hexafluoropropylene oxide (poly-HFPO) alcohol was prepared by the reduction of the corresponding methyl ester using NaBH4, NaBD4, or LiAlH4 (LAH). This alcohol is a versatile starting material for the preparation of additional interesting compounds. Because of its expected poor nucleophilicity, before attempting additional reactions, we have found it advantageous to prepare a corresponding salt. We have found that the resulting salt behaved like a normal hydrocarbon alkoxide. The reaction of this salt with either acetyl chloride or allyl chloride (or bromide) gave the expected products which proved to be normal nucleophilic substitutions. In addition, the bromination of the allyl ether was studied using NMR and GC/MS techniques.
